Like the Negro March on Washington movement before it, the Double V campaign quickly became popular in black communities across the nation. One poll concluded that the campaign enjoyed a 91-percent approval rating among African Americans. The idea of fighting for victory abroad and at home swiftly wove itself into the fabric of black American life.
